# This block configures the Driftwatch client, which streams config
# changes so the app can hot-reload without restarts. If reloads stop,
# check the client's heartbeat log first — a stale heartbeat almost
# always means an auth failure, not a network issue. The client
# authenticates to the internal Driftwatch hub with the key below.

app token of bahaf-tajeg = zpat23_SjjsllwiLmXbtS65veZaV47

Q: A PR updates dozens of UI snapshots — how do I review that?

A: Don't eyeball every diff. In Larkspur, snapshot churn usually traces to one shared component; find that root change and verify it's intentional. Reject blanket snapshot updates with no explanation, and ask for a visual-diff run when layout shifts. Approved churn thresholds and the visual-diff workflow for reviewers are documented on the page below.

wiki page, tahaf-tajog: https://jira.ordindyn.corp/pipeline

You're on call for Spoonwright, our recipe-scaling calculator, and flagged as this quarter's security reviewer. Key points: unit-conversion input is user-supplied and has bitten us before, so watch the parser alerts. Rate limits live at the gateway; don't loosen them without sign-off. Past findings, threat notes, and the review checklist are collected on the internal page below.

operations page: https://jira.qorvelsys.internal/browse/pages/browse/pages

# Approvals: Encoding Detection for Uploads

Quick note for reviewers: the Textwarden service sniffs uploaded text files to guess encoding before normalizing everything to UTF-8. Because bad detection can mangle content (or worse, smuggle odd byte sequences past filters), any change to the detection heuristics needs an explicit security approval — no exceptions, even for "tiny" threshold tweaks. Approvals get logged on this page, and the final sign-off always comes from a single designated approver. That person is listed below.

named custodian: Belius Casath Ulaix Sorius